    “The modern presidency is something of a media invention, partly out of convenience – we need a protagonist, a character through which to tell the story of American politics” (Achenbach). There is no argument that the President hold enormous influence on the nation and the world. By going public the President can gather support directly from citizens for a certain law, bill, treaty, war, etc., and while he or she might not be able to rally the entire nation in his or her favor, an address from the President has a tremendous pull on the nation or will at least get the world talking. But when it comes to policy making, the President influence is much more limited. For example, although the President can institute executive orders, these orders can be overturned by congressional hearing, judicial review, or the next president in office.…
